It features many important operations and methods: matrix norm, matrix transposition, matrix inverse, determinant of a matrix, order and numerical condition of a matrix, scalar product of vectors, vector product of vectors, vector length, projection of row and column vectors, a comfortable way for reading in a matrix from a file, the keyboard or your code, and many more. . It allows one to solve linear equation systems using an efficient algorithm known as "L-R-decomposition" and several approximative (iterative) methods. . It features an implementation of Kleene's algorithm to compute the minimal costs for all paths in a graph with weighted edges (the "weights" being the costs associated with each edge). . Finally, it allows one to solve the eigensystem of a real symmetric matrix, using Householder transformation and QL decomposition.
